Output 87c44b43f5b30ea6da2ee9cfc360c053c804d7df08a209f420f9bf25953bfe11:4

value
18500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2618f2421a398bbd4dadd8c58f8d23f856001de OP_EQUAL
address
3KQotHc2S4viQFcx2RoZeTj3Srt5Tf8dN6
transaction
87c44b43f5b30ea6da2ee9cfc360c053c804d7df08a209f420f9bf25953bfe11
spent
true